With her sweeping curves and spirited performance, the Predator 62 combines the aggressive styling and engineering excellence the Sunseeker brand is known for throughout the world. Built on a deep-V hull with a wide 16'5"" beam and prop pockets to level the engines, the opulent interior of the Predator 62 is a stunning display of satin-finished walnut woodwork, posh leather seating, and designer hardware and fabrics. The 62 boasts the largest living area in her class with a huge main deck salon with hydraulic sunroof and double sliding aft doors that open to a large outdoor seating area. Below, the fully equipped galley with granite counters and hardwood flooring is to port in the salon, opposite a U-shaped settee dining area with folding table. The forward VIP cabin with island queen berth has private access to the day head. Aft through the salon is a Pullman guest cabin on the starboard side. A fantastic feature of the Predator 62 is her full-beam amidships master stateroom with walkaround queen berth, settee, and vanity. A hydraulic swim platform and tender garage are standard, and the engine room offers good access to the motors. MAN 1100hp V-drive engines cruise at 2728 knots (low 30s top).
